Masses and widths of scalar-isoscalar multi-channel resonances from data analysis
Original language description
The peculiarities of obtaining parameters for broad multi-channel resonances from data are discussed, analyzing the experimental data on processes pi pi -> pi pi, K (K) over bar in the I(G)J(PC) = 0(+)0(++) channel in a model-independent approach based on analyticity and unitarity, and using an uniformization procedure. We show that it is possible to obtain a good description of the pi pi scattering data from the threshold to 1.89 GeV with parameters of resonances cited in the Particle Data Group tablesas preferred. However, in this case, first, the representation of the pi pi background is unsatisfactory; second, the data on the coupled process pi pi -> K (K) over bar are not well described even qualitatively above 1.15 GeV when using the resonance parameters from only the pi pi scattering analysis.
